Sandeep vs State Of U P And Another

High Court Of Judicature at Allahabad|06 January, 2021
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

Court No. - 71
Case :- CRIMINAL MISC. BAIL APPLICATION No. - 28436 of 2020 Applicant :- Sandeep Opposite Party :- State of U.P. and Another Counsel for Applicant :- Azhar Ahmad Counsel for Opposite Party :- G.A.
Hon'ble Ram Krishna Gautam,J.
By means of this application the applicant Sandeep has prayed to release him on bail in Case Crime No. 419 of 2019 u/s 363, 366, 376 I.P.C. and Section 3/4 Protection of Children from Sexual Offences Act, P.S. Civil Lines, District Etawah.
Heard learned counsel for the applicant and learned AGA representing the State. Perused the record.
Learned counsel for the applicant argued that the applicant is innocent and he has been falsely implicated in this very case crime number. Applicant is in jail since 16.6.2020 and there is no likelihood of applicant's fleeing from course of justice or tempering with evidence in case he is released on bail. He is of no criminal antecedents. Prosecutrix in her statement recorded under Sections 161 and 164 Cr.P.C. as well as before Medical Board has categorically said to be under affairs with applicant and married voluntarily with the applicant. She has been held to be of 17 years in medical age determination by medical board though she is major. This 17 years may be with two years variation either way. Hence bail has been prayed for during trial.
Learned AGA has vehemently opposed the bail application but could not dispute this fact that applicant is of no criminal history.
Even after sufficient notice, none appears on behalf of the informant.
Having heard and gone through the material placed on record, it is apparent that prosecutrix in her statement recorded under Sections 161 & 164 Cr.P.C. has said nothing incriminating against the applicant. Rather, she said herself to be legally wedded with the applicant. She has been held to be 17 years of medical age determination by the Medical Board, this may be with two years variation either way.
Under all above facts and circumstances, the nature of accusations, severity of the punishment in the case of conviction and without expressing any opinion on the merits of the case, this court is of the view that the applicant may be enlarged on bail with certain conditions.
Accordingly, the bail application is allowed.
Let the applicant, Sandeep , involved in above mentioned case crime number be released on bail on his executing a personal bond and two reliable sureties each in the like amount to the satisfaction of the court concerned subject to the following conditions:
1. The applicant will not tamper with the evidence.
2. The applicant will not indulge in any criminal activity.
3. The applicant will not pressurize/intimidate the prosecution witnesses and co-operate in the trial.
4. The applicant will appear regularly on each and every date fixed by the trial court unless his personal appearance is exempted through counsel by the court concerned.
In the event of breach of any of the aforesaid conditions, the court below will be at liberty to proceed to cancel his bail.
Order Date :- 6.1.2021 Ravi Prakash
